What is accounting software coding?

Accounting software coding involves designing, developing, and maintaining computer programs that help businesses manage their financial transactions and records. This can include building features for invoicing, payroll, expense tracking, and reporting based on accounting principles. Professionals in this field need a strong understanding of both software development and accounting practices to ensure accuracy and compliance. These specialists often work with programming languages like Python, Java, or C#, and may integrate their solutions with other business systems.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in Accounting Software Coding, and why are they important?

To thrive in Accounting Software Coding, you need strong programming skills (often in languages like Java, C#, or Python), a solid understanding of accounting principles, and a relevant degree in computer science or accounting. Experience with ERP systems, accounting software platforms (like QuickBooks or SAP), and familiarity with databases and APIs are typically required. Analytical thinking, problem-solving, and effective communication are valuable soft skills for collaborating with stakeholders and troubleshooting complex issues. These skills and qualities are crucial to building reliable, compliant, and user-friendly accounting solutions that meet business needs.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als coding for accounting software, and how can they be addressed?

Professionals coding for accounting software often encounter challenges such as ensuring compliance with evolving financial regulations, handling complex data integrations, and maintaining data security. It’s crucial to stay up-to-date with accounting standards and work closely with domain experts to design accurate financial modules. Additionally, collaborating with QA teams to rigorously test features helps catch errors early, and following secure coding practices minimizes risks related to sensitive financial data.

Senior Accountant/Accounting Manager

Work from Home within the Continental United States

About Us:

@Orchard LLC is a WOSB mission-driven professional services firm supporting federal and commercial clients across scientific, environmental, and technical domains. We support our customers while building a lean, entrepreneurial business. We’re looking for a hands-on Senior Accountant/Accounting Manager to own our accounting, finance, and compliance functions.

About the Role:

This position is a hands-on, one-person accounting function designed to bridge the gap between transactional data and executive decision-making. The primary objective is to transform the existing accounting foundation into a source of reliable financial intelligence. This individual will personally manage the full spectrum of accounting & financial operations, from ensuring the accuracy of initial coding to delivering high-level strategic projections.

You’ll be the cornerstone of our back office - working directly in QuickBooks, Paylocity, and Beebole to process transactions, close the books, manage cash, and ensure compliance with government contracting requirements. You’ll also maintain our profiles in government systems (SAM.gov, IPP, etc.), manage insurance programs, and keep our records audit-ready.

Responsibilities:

  • Own all day-to-day accounting functions, ensuring precision in a lean, small-business environment.
  • Standardize the month-end close and re-engineer accounting process architectures to ensure data integrity and scalable workflows.
  • Engineer advanced management reporting packages, including granular cost visibility, task order, and customer P&Ls, cash flow forecasting, and annual budgeting.
  • Manage full-lifecycle GovCon accounting, specifically complex task-order setups, compliant billing cycles, and DCAA reporting.
  • Manage company profiles in SAM.gov, IPP, and other government systems.
  • Keep all financial, insurance, and compliance records organized, backed up, and audit-ready.
  • Maintain compliance with DCAA, FAR/DFARS, indirect rates, and contract billing.
  • Oversee insurance renewals and risk management.

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field.
  • CPA, CMA, or comparable professional certification/license is strongly preferred.
  • 5-10 years of hands-on accounting experience, including a proven track record of owning the accounting function for a small business
  • Strong reporting skills with the ability to build complex reconciliations and custom reports outside of standard accounting software.
  • Advanced proficiency in MS Excel, QuickBooks, and Paylocity; experience with integrated timekeeping systems is required.
  • Comfortable working in a small, entrepreneurial business where you will own the work, not just manage it.
  • Preference: Significant experience in government contracting (familiarity with DCAA, FAR/DFARS, indirect rate, and billing) is a major plus.

Why Join Us?

If you want to be the key accounting, finance, and compliance leader in a small business where your work has an immediate impact, this is the role. You’ll own the systems, re-architect the processes, and ensure the company is always financially sound and audit-ready.

Compensation: The base salary is dependent on qualifications and experience and is expected to be in the range of $80,000-$90,000 annually. Benefits are provided, including PTO, health, dental, and vision.
